PHP Markdown vs WebsitePainter: The Verdict

⚡ Summary:

PHP Markdown: PHP Markdown is an open-source PHP library that converts Markdown formatted text to HTML. It supports most standard Markdown syntax and allows adding extensions for additional functionality.

WebsitePainter: WebsitePainter is a user-friendly website builder that allows anyone to easily create professional-looking websites without coding. It has an intuitive drag-and-drop interface, hundreds of customizable templates, and built-in SEO tools.
